Transaction 8aaa459ec3cd75aa7698a70161eb60dc4e0521d407f5b21d934a3267f0b2732c

2 Input
1 Outputs
  • 8aaa459ec3cd75aa7698a70161eb60dc4e0521d407f5b21d934a3267f0b2732c:0
  • value  386250
    address  3MWGtyVdCXAasfkTC5J5jrYaphRfC9mRXL